[ovs-dev] [PATCH v6 1/3] ovsdb-server.7: Mention update3 as replies to monitor_cond_change.
Dumitru Ceara
dceara at redhat.com
Thu May 28 12:32:17 UTC 2020
Monitor_cond_change might trigger updates to be sent to clients as results
to condition changes. These updates can be either update2 (for monitor_cond
monitors) or update3 (for monitor_cond_since monitors). The documentation
used to mention only update2.
